This page summarizes major baseball terms used on player pages.

Pitching Stats

TermDescription
Games Started (GS)Pitcher who starts the game.
Complete Games (CG)Starter finishes the entire game without relief, even if it ends before 9 innings.
Shutouts (SHO)Complete game with zero runs allowed.
No WalksOuting with zero walks allowed.
Wins (W)Credited to the qualifying winning pitcher in a team win.
Losses (L)Charged to the pitcher responsible for the decisive run.
Saves (SV)Given to a reliever who finishes a win under save conditions.
Holds (HLD)Relief appearance preserving the lead before handing off.
Winning PercentageWins / (Wins + Losses).
Batters Faced (BF)Total number of batters faced.
Innings Pitched (IP)Outs recorded divided by 3. Example: 7.2 means 7 and 2/3 innings.
Hits Allowed (H)Hits allowed.
Home Runs Allowed (HR)Home runs allowed.
Walks Allowed (BB)Walks issued.
Intentional Walks (IBB, Pitcher)Intentional walks issued by the pitcher.
Hit Batters (HBP)Hit batters.
Strikeouts (SO/K)Batters retired by strikeout.
Wild Pitches (WP)Pitch not ordinarily catchable by the catcher.
Balks (BK)Illegal pitching motion with runners on base.
Runs Allowed (R)Total runs allowed (earned + unearned).
Earned Runs (ER)Runs charged to the pitcher as earned runs.
Earned Run Average (ERA)(ER x 9) / IP.
WHIP(BB + H) / IP.

Fielding Stats

TermDescription
Putouts (PO)Outs completed directly by the fielder.
Assists (A)Plays where the fielder contributes to an out.
Errors (E)Fielding mistakes that allow runners to reach/advance.
Double Plays (DP)Plays producing two or more outs in one sequence.
Fielding Percentage (FPCT)(PO + A) / (PO + A + E).

Batting Stats

TermDescription
Plate Appearances (PA)Total plate appearances.
At-Bats (AB)PA - (BB + HBP + SH + SF + interference).
Runs (R)Times scored.
Hits (H)Total hits.
Doubles (2B)Hit where batter reaches second base.
Triples (3B)Hit where batter reaches third base.
Home Runs (HR)Home runs.
Total Bases (TB)1Bx1 + 2Bx2 + 3Bx3 + HRx4.
Runs Batted In (RBI)Runs driven in by batting results.
Stolen Bases (SB)Successful steals.
Caught Stealing (CS)Failed steal attempts resulting in outs.
Sacrifice Bunts (SH)Successful sacrifice bunts.
Sacrifice Flies (SF)Successful sacrifice flies.
Walks (BB)Base on balls.
Intentional Walks (IBB, Batter)Intentional walks received.
Hit By Pitch (HBP)Times reached base by hit pitch.
Strikeouts (SO/K)Times struck out.
Grounded Into Double Play (GIDP)Times batter hits into a double play.
Batting Average (AVG)H / AB.
On-Base Percentage (OBP)(H + BB + HBP) / (AB + BB + HBP + SF).
Slugging Percentage (SLG)TB / AB.
OPSOBP + SLG. Summary indicator of offensive production.
